We are looking for a capable and proactive Law Clerk with 2–3 years of practical legal experience to support our legal team. This role is ideal for someone progressing toward admission as a solicitor or seeking to build on their experience in a high-performing legal environment. The successful candidate will assist with substantive legal work, including research, drafting, and matter management, while also playing a key role in supporting senior legal staff.

Key Responsibilities:

Conduct in-depth legal research and provide analysis to support litigation, advisory, or transactional work

Draft a range of legal documents including contracts, pleadings, briefs, affidavits, legal opinions, and correspondence

Assist in file management across all stages of legal matters—from instruction through to resolution

Prepare bundles for court proceedings or regulatory submissions

Attend client meetings, mediations, or court (as required) and take detailed notes or minutes

Liaise with clients, counsel, courts, and third parties in a professional and timely manner

Ensure all work complies with firm policies and legal ethical obligations
